Система учёта комплектующих/запчастей на небольшом предприятии

IVAN-DM
Дата: 25.05.2017 12:33:00
День добрый!
Планируем сделать складскую систему учёта комплектующих/запчастей. Помогите определиться выбором платформы разработки. Необходимо учитывать расход и приход материала - фиксировать кто, когда, сколько и чего себе выписал. Это необходимо для планирования закупок и передачи данных в бухгалтерию (списания мат. средств). У каждого специалиста работающего со складом (сейчас около 7 человек) есть свой компьютер в локальной сети с MS office и один на всех серверный компьютер. Фирма небольшая в принципе хватило бы и excel-файлика на сетевом диске, но хочется:
1. что-то более удобное и легко масштабируемое в будущем
2. разграничение прав доступа
3. передавать необходимые данные в 1С (в перспективе)
4. выбирать для получения со склада как произвольные позиции, так и предварительно подготовленные типовые наборы комплектующих

Пока самым реальным вариантом представляется реализовать это всё на базе MS Access, который будет запущен на серверном. К нему будут подключаться клиенты (посредством форм MS Access) и работать с единой "акцеосовской" базой данных. Но в Access полно своей экзотики - типо VB и своей собственной базы-данных. Реализуемы ли пункты №2,3,4 в MS Access?

Ещё рассматривается вариант с использованием более распространённых баз данных, например - MySql на серверном компьютере и запускаемые на клиентских компьютерах windows-приложения на C#. При таком варианте, на сколько я понимаю, реализуемо вообще всё что угодно (хотя и дольше-сложнее). Ещё бытует мнение что в 2017 году клиентскую часть уже делают исключительно посредством Web, так ли это? Подбирать-покупать уже готовую систему по некоторым причинам не хочется.
LSV
Дата: 25.05.2017 13:08:15
IVAN-DM,

У вас слишком мало ресурсов, чтоб самим сделать такой проект, да еще и с нуля ...
Аксесс для вас пожалуй лучшее решение.
И нужно еще уметь писать подобные решения. Там не все так просто, как кажется.

Чем не угодил 1С с готовым складом ?
IVAN-DM
Дата: 25.05.2017 14:31:34
LSV,

Ну есть на то свои причины. Нужно разработать именно что-то своё и не облажаться. Наверное действительно будем смотреть в сторону MS Access (пускай и со всей его экзотикой, но при этом - более лёгкой). Спасибо!
Garya
Дата: 25.05.2017 18:22:17
За разработку собственной системы берутся, как правило, "не стреляные воробьи" по принципу "что нам стоит дом построить, нам ведь море по колено". Лучше выбирайте не платформу для разработки, а готовое решение.

IVAN-DM
Нужно разработать именно что-то своё и не облажаться
Одного моего знакомого не устроили все производимые модели автомобилей, и он решил произвести автомобиль собственными руками... :)

Нет, конечно же, находятся отдельно взятые кулибины, которые делают нечто этакое-разэтакое, причем, очень неплохо. Но их немного. А подавляющее большинство делает что-нибудь убогое, потом понимает, что там накосячили, сям накосячили, пытаются исправить там, потом сям, потом, наконец, понимают, что переделывать нужно абсолютно всё и с нуля и начинают переделывать всё и с нуля. Потом опять выясняют, что там что-то не предусмотрели, сям что-то опять не так... Потом, наконец, начинают знакомиться с готовыми решениями, и, наконец, понимают, что пытались изобрести давно уже изобретенный велосипед.
s_ustinov
Дата: 25.05.2017 18:36:28
Garya
Потом, наконец, начинают знакомиться с готовыми решениями, и, наконец, понимают, что пытались изобрести давно уже изобретенный велосипед.

+100500
Сама по себе очень простая система для склада у вас, вероятно, получится. Но через некоторое время вам захочется расширить функционал. Потом еще расширить и еще... И вот тут то и будет БОЛЬ.
Злой Бобр
Дата: 25.05.2017 21:45:58
IVAN-DM
...
3. передавать необходимые данные в 1С (в перспективе)
...

Ну так берите 1С и не разводите зоопарк.
IVAN-DM
Дата: 26.05.2017 10:32:24
Всем спасибо за участие =)